Hisar (146) is a Both village located in Hisar, Hisar, Haryana.
The total population of Hisar (146) is 7,641.
Hisar (146) village comprises 1,530 households.
The literacy rate in Hisar (146) is 80.7%. Among the literate population of 5,417, there are 3,176 literate males and 2,241 literate females.
In Hisar (146), there are 4,065 males and 3,576 females, with a sex ratio of 880 females per 1000 males.
There are 932 children (12.2% of population), comprising 514 boys and 418 girls.
The total number of workers in Hisar (146) is 2,218, with 2,006 main workers and 212 marginal workers.
In Hisar (146), there are 2,292 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(1,215 males, 1,077 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Hisar (146) is located in Haryana state, Hisar district, and falls under Hisar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 60890 and LGD code is 60890.
